
B.A. (Hons.) in Bangla at S.B.S.S. College Overview
S.B.S.S. College, Lalit Narayan Mithila University offers B.A. (Hons.) in Bangla programme at the UG level. This course is offered in Full Time mode with a duration of 3 years. Students need to pay INR 387 as the total tuition fee and as the hostel fee. Students can check details around B.A. (Hons.) in Bangla offered at S.B.S.S. College, Lalit Narayan Mithila University below:

Humanities as a stream provides a wide range of courses that can be studied after completing their 12th grade. Pursuing any of these degrees prepares you to understand the various levels of humanities and, as a result, carve out an appropriate job path. Candidates in the humanities can apply for positions in the government sector, such as banking firms, government ministries, legal firms, and political analysts.
Content Writer, Civil Services, Human Resource Manager, Defense Services, Lawyer, Journalist, Counsellor, and Therapist positions are available. As freshers, humanities graduates can expect to earn between INR 2-6 LPA.
